School Routines:

ARRIVING AT SCHOOL:  Children are not expected to arrive at school before 8:35am.  No supervision is available for your child before this time. Children who do arrive at school before 8:35am MUST remain seated in the Kindergarten & Year 1 eating area until the teacher arrives on duty.

CHILDREN BEING COLLECTED AFTER  SCHOOL:

Byng Street Site – Parent pickup only.  Parents are to meet the children on the lines under the shade cloth next to the Byng St building. There is ample parking on Byng Street.
Hill Street Parent Pick up – Limited parking. Parents meet children in Area A in the Kindergarten & Year 1 eating area.
Hill Street Bus Exit – Children meet between Kenna hall and the school, near the Kinder exit and will be taken to Kenna Hall to wait for their buses. Children must be walked to the bus by the teacher on duty. If your child misses the bus for any reason the school will make every effort to contact you.  We will keep your child safe in the office until they are picked up.
